What are the long-term implications of regulatory shifts on battery manufacturing safety standards in Singapore?
The increasing stringency of safety regulations surrounding battery manufacturing in Singapore, driven by both national policies and international safety standards, has profound long-term implications for industry stakeholders. According to the Singapore Standards Council, recent updates to safety protocols emphasize the adoption of advanced safety features in battery production equipment, including integrated thermal management and real-time fault detection. This regulatory evolution compels manufacturers to upgrade their manufacturing lines with sophisticated, compliant spot welding machinery capable of meeting these new standards. Moreover, the International Electrotechnical Commission (IEC) and Singapore’s Enterprise Singapore are pushing for harmonization of safety standards with global benchmarks, fostering a more competitive and innovation-driven landscape.
In the long term, these regulatory shifts will likely accelerate the adoption of Industry 4.0-enabled smart welding solutions, promoting automation and predictive maintenance to enhance safety and quality. Companies that proactively align their product development and compliance strategies with these evolving standards will reduce operational risks and liability, gaining competitive advantages. Furthermore, as Singapore positions itself as a leader in safe and sustainable battery manufacturing, local firms and multinational corporations will need to invest heavily in R&D to develop compliant, eco-friendly, and efficient welding technologies—potentially opening avenues for export growth and regional market leadership.
How is Singapore’s commitment to sustainable manufacturing influencing innovation in battery spot welding technologies?
Singapore’s strong commitment to sustainable manufacturing, driven by national policies such as the Singapore Green Plan 2030 and the Industrial Transformation Map, is significantly shaping innovation within the battery spot welding sector. The government’s push for environmentally friendly industrial practices encourages the development of low-energy consumption welding solutions that minimize carbon footprints. This has led to increased R&D investments in eco-efficient welding equipment featuring energy recovery systems, reduced emissions, and recyclable component materials.
According to the World Bank’s latest data, Singapore aims to achieve a 50% reduction in industrial greenhouse gas emissions by 2040, which directly influences technological innovation in manufacturing equipment. Industry stakeholders are now exploring the integration of AI and IoT to enable smarter, more precise welding processes that optimize energy use and reduce waste. Breakthroughs such as multi-material compatible welders and automation in battery pack assembly are gaining traction, aligning with global best practices for sustainability. This focus on eco-innovation not only enhances Singapore’s competitiveness but also aligns with international environmental standards, fostering trust among global partners and customers seeking sustainable supply chains.
